MindyJohn Posted May 3, 2017 #3705 Share Posted May 3, 2017 port fees and taxes are 600 on the segment with Suez Canal in it[/quote Stopping in Aqaba is expensive! We were on the long end of the stick in 2012 on Voyager for the leg between Barcelona and Dubai. Originally there was NOT a stop at Aqaba and our taxes were only $58. Within a few months of opening, the itinerary change was announced and anyone who reserved afterwards had to pay nearly $200 more in taxes, but we were locked in at $58 :D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Clarea Posted May 3, 2017 #3714 Share Posted May 3, 2017 Could you explain what GAP is? I've never heard this term before. Are they offered on select cruises, and if so, how do you know about them ahead of time? Is it publicized somewhere? ... GAP is Group Amenity Program. It's a way of giving travel agents perks to give to guests for group bookings. RC can designate a certain number of GAP points for sailings. They can be used for various things, like OBC, cocktail party, etc.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
